Don't think it will work. Your problem is 129W. The 118.75W HD locals are duplicated on 129W. When you run your check switch and get everthing set up, your receiver will only look to 129W for the locals. Only way you will see them on 118W is to not have 129 active.

This isn't the problem at least for the moment. Got the dish 500+ peaked out today. The problem is St. Louis is on 3 tps ; 11,18 & 21. 11 is 37, 21 is 28, and 18 is only 10 at best. 17 which is the one I peaked all the sats on was in the mid to upper 30's at the dish. Now it's only 33, I've got some kind of line loss that is outrageous. So will have to see what can be done about that before I can say wheater it works or not. I don't seem to have the line loss on 110 & 119 though(50's & 60's). So something else is the problem.
